Ways of using next-font in nextjs project
import { Lato } from 'next/font/google'
import { DM_Sans } from 'next/font/google'
const lato = Lato({
weight: ['100', '300', '400', '700', '900'],
subsets: ['latin'],
variable: '--font-lato',
})
const dm_sans = DM_Sans({
weight: ['400', '500', '700'],
subsets: ['latin'],
variable: '--font-dm-sans',
})
// Now you can use it by two ways in app
// 1. Use variable
